New Orleans, LA All-Time Weather Extremes

The most extreme temperature, precipitation, and snowfall ever recorded in New Orleans, from NOAA daily weather observations.

Station: NEW ORLEANS AUDUBON
All-time weather extremes for New Orleans, LA, from NOAA daily observations at NEW ORLEANS AUDUBON
Temperature
Record High104°F (40°C)June 24, 2009 and August 28, 2023
Record Low6°F (-14°C)February 13, 1899
Lowest High24.9°F (-4°C)January 11, 1962
Highest Low84.9°F (29°C)August 10, 1899 and October 5, 1951 and August 8, 1980
Highest Mean92.5°F (34°C)July 15, 1980 and August 22, 1980 and June 26, 2012
Lowest Mean17.4°F (-8°C)February 13, 1899
Precipitation
Max in One Calendar Day13.08" (332.2 mm)October 2, 1937
Max in One Month23.25" (590.6 mm)December 2009
Least in One Month0.00" (0.0 mm)May 1898
Max in One Year111.81" (2840.1 mm)1991
Least in One Year33.11" (841.0 mm)1917
Snowfall
Max in One Calendar Day10.0" (25.4 cm)February 14, 1895
Max in One Month10.0" (25.4 cm)February 1895
Max in One Season10.0" (25.4 cm)1894-95
Max in One Year10.0" (25.4 cm)1895
Earliest Snow9.6" (24.4 cm)November 14, 1906
Earliest Measurable Snow9.6" (24.4 cm)November 14, 1906
Latest Snow10.0" (25.4 cm)February 14, 1895
Latest Measurable Snow10.0" (25.4 cm)February 14, 1895
Period of Record
TemperatureJanuary 1, 1893 – January 28, 2025
PrecipitationJanuary 13, 1893 – January 28, 2025
SnowfallJanuary 1, 1893 – December 31, 2010

Note: Records compiled from NOAA GHCN-Daily observations at NEW ORLEANS AUDUBON (4 mi from New Orleans, LA). Quality-flagged readings are excluded. Monthly and annual totals require substantially complete reporting for “least” records.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the hottest temperature ever recorded in New Orleans, LA?

The all-time record high in New Orleans, LA is 104°F (40°C), set on June 24, 2009 and August 28, 2023.

What is the coldest temperature ever recorded in New Orleans, LA?

The all-time record low in New Orleans, LA is 6°F (-14°C), set on February 13, 1899.

What is the most rain New Orleans, LA has ever had in one day?

The most precipitation recorded in one calendar day near New Orleans, LA is 13.08 inches, on October 2, 1937.

What is the biggest snowfall ever recorded in New Orleans, LA?

The most snow recorded in one calendar day near New Orleans, LA is 10.0 inches, on February 14, 1895.
